Explore the full range of solutions Helpware divisions provide:

Java development company

With 800+ seasoned software engineers on board, Helpware Tech transforms businesses through impactful Java development services. We apply 20+ years of experience to develop scalable, high-performance, and secure digital solutions tailored to your requirements.

We can augment your in-house team with skilled Java developers or build a dedicated team to work exclusively on your project. With a 93% customer satisfaction score and 80% returning clients, HW.Tech is your trusted Java development company for all your Java initiatives.

Java development company trusted by leading brands
personify health logo
COMPIQ logo
publicics groupe logo
google logo
microsoft logo
StubHub international logo
pfizer logo
a blue and black background

Java development services we deliver

Our team of Java developers provides a comprehensive range of Java development services, covering every product creation step—from tech consulting to software maintenance and support.
Custom Java development
Forget vendor lock-ins, customization limitations, and scalability bottlenecks. Our Java developers build custom web, mobile, and cross-platform applications specifically for your use case and business objectives. We begin with in-depth business analysis to ensure your software includes exactly what you need, avoiding unnecessary features leading to performance-draining bloat. As a result, you receive a Java solution that supports your workflows without disruption.
Java web development
Provide a consistent user experience, widen your audience, and scale effortlessly with our Java web development services. We use Spring Framework, Jakarta EE, JSF, and other frameworks to create user-friendly, high-performance, and cross-browser web apps that work smoothly on every device and operating system. Our solutions are designed with the end user in mind, prioritizing smooth user journeys, straightforward navigation, and eye-catching UIs.
Java mobile app development
Provide fingertip access to your services, reach your clients on the go, and increase brand visibility with custom Java development for mobile. Our experts leverage Android SDK, Android Studio, Jetpack libraries, and other technologies to build feature-rich applications for Android smartphones, tablets, and wearables. We develop mobile banking apps, parking navigators, telemedicine applications, and other apps that solve business problems across industries.
Java consulting
Overcome business challenges, validate your ideas, and eliminate inefficiencies in business processes through Java consultancy. Our experienced team thoroughly assesses your needs, identifies the most effective solutions, evaluates their technical feasibility, and creates a comprehensive development plan with an ROI estimate on time and resource savings. You receive a KPI roadmap from Day 1, ensuring measurable outcomes.

More services

Java cloud development
Reduce computing, storage, and networking costs by up to 66% and market your solutions 37% faster by migrating to the cloud. Our Java developers utilize Spring Cloud, Jakarta EE, as well as a wide range of AWS, Google Cloud, and Microsoft Azure technologies to engineer bespoke private, public, and hybrid cloud solutions. Our services include cloud infrastructure management, cloud-native development, cloud migration, deployment automation, and more.
Java integration and migration
Unlock peak performance, scalability, and cost-efficiency by migrating your legacy systems to Java. Our expert Java development team ensures seamless data migration with minimal to no disruptions to your business operations. We integrate your existing systems with modern Java solutions to enable better collaboration and eliminate silos. You receive a tailored migration strategy that delivers measurable results and results in a future-proof infrastructure.
Team augmentation with Java developers
Bridge talent gaps in your in-house team and accelerate time to market by tapping into our Java development expertise. We integrate our best Java developers into your team within 10 business days, saving you up to 60% on in-house recruiting costs. You get a 14-day trial to assess a candidate: If they don’t fit your project, we’ll provide a new one at no cost, with unlimited attempts to find the ideal match. Plus, we offer a 20% discount during the trial period.
Java maintenance and support
Reach optimal performance and avoid expensive downtime with ongoing maintenance and support for Java apps. Our team uses Grafana, Sentry, DataDog, New Relic, and other observability tools to continuously monitor your system and spot issues before they cause disruptions. We provide L2 and L3 support along with a range of maintenance services, such as app upgrades, security management, performance management, and compliance management.

Java app development company with certified expertise

ISO certified company Quality management system 9001:2015 badge
AICPA Soc 2 Type 1 badge
America's fasttest growing private comapnies (Inc. 5000) badge
ISO certified company (27001:2013) badge
IAOP 2024 Global Outsourcing 100 badge
trusted by gartner badge
AWS
AWS certified company SysOps administrator associate badge
AWS certified company developer associate badge
AWS certified company solutions architect associate badge
AWS certified company solutions architect professional badge
AWS certified company cloud practitioner foundational badge
Clutch global spring 2024 badge
Best company career growth 2024 badge

Save 60% over in-house recruiting with Java development outsourcing

Your satisfaction is our #1 priority. To ensure you have the best experience with our Java development services, we offer benefits you won’t find elsewhere.
Onboarding in 10 days
Get your first CVs in 5 days. Onboard senior-level experts in just 10. Bring your product to market faster and outpace the competition.
60% cost savings
Reduce hiring expenses by up to 60%. Hire top Java developers without paying top dollar. Save on employee benefits, training, equipment, office space, and payroll taxes.
14-day trial with a 20% discount
Gain access to a 14-day trial program. Properly assess each candidate to ensure cultural alignment and technical capability. Enjoy a 20% discount during the trial.
Top 1% LATAM & Philippines tech talent
Access 5000+ pre-vetted top-tier talents with market-specific expertise from Latin America, Asia, and Europe. Maximize your budget without compromising quality.
93% of our clients recommend our Java development services*
* according to our customer survey
200+
completed projects
20
years in business
5
years average length of client relationship
800+
seasoned software engineers
5000+
tech talent pool worldwide
18
global offices
4.5
years average team tenure
80%
customer return rate
93%
customer satisfaction score
a blue and purple gradient
a blue and purple gradient

Technology stack for custom Java development

Our Java developers are proficient in all major Java frameworks and platforms, as well as other programming languages, allowing us to deliver custom Java software development services of any complexity.
Java frameworks
Platforms
Other programming languages and frameworks
Python tech stack
ruby on rails logo
Go logo
php logo
Swift logo
Kotlin logo
react logo
react native logo
vue js logo
typescript logo
javascript logo
rust programming language logo
Data solutions
logo
elasticsearch logo
logo 2
mongoDB logo
logo 4
logo 5
DevOps
logo
docker logo
HELM logo
PostgreSQL logo
jenkins logo
kubernetes logo
logo 6
msk logo
logo 8
logo 9
ml flow logo
flux logo
logo 12
Big data & machine learning
snowflake logo
looker logo
fivetran logo
logo logo
TensorFlow logo
dbt logo
databricks logo
pyTorch logo
Cloud
azure logo
aws logo
google cloud logo
Monitoring & observability
grafana logo
sentry logo
new relic logo

Overcome your challenges with Java development outsourcing

Struggling to translate your idea into a tangible solution? As a reliable Java application development company, HW.Tech empowers you to overcome the most pressing challenges.
01
Talent shortage. Finding the right talent is hard. We provide access to over 5000 pre-vetted tech experts worldwide, so you can easily bridge expertise gaps in your in-house team.
02
Laborious recruitment. It takes 6–12 weeks to find suitable candidates for your Java project. We’ll integrate our Java developers into your team within as little as 10 business days.
03
Overhead costs. In-house hiring comes with high overhead. We reduce recruiting, payroll, and training costs, saving you up to 60%.
04
Lack of flexibility. In-house recruitment is rigid. Outsource your project and scale your team up or down on demand without being constrained by local labor laws and long-term contracts.
05
Long time to market. Recruitment challenges slow you down. Our Java developers quickly integrate into your team and deliver value from Day 1, allowing you to market faster.
06
Unmet expectations. Finding a Java team that aligns with your needs is difficult. We consider your budget, location, product vision, and business goals to recommend the best talent.

Why opt for custom Java development?

Platform independencyJava follows the “write once, run anywhere” principle and is platform-independent at both the source and binary levels. You can run the same Java code across devices and platforms with little to no modification, which reduces development costs while accelerating time to market.
Rich APIsJava comes with a comprehensive set of APIs for data management, networking, and other tasks, so you can extend your solution’s functionality. These APIs speed up the development process, minimize maintenance costs, and reduce the need for third-party libraries.
SecurityJava supports advanced security features, including bytecode verification, exception handling, memory management, and sandboxing. With them, you can rest assured that your customers’ sensitive data will be protected against cybersecurity threats and vulnerabilities.
ScalabilityJava makes scaling trouble-free. Thanks to its modularity and ability to handle distributed systems, this programming language perfectly suits both small-scale software solutions and enterprise-grade projects.
a blue and purple gradient

Our industry expertise

Our Java software development services transform business operations for healthcare, pharmaceutical, and fintech organizations.

Healthcare

Improving healthcare delivery and achieving better patient outcomes with telemedicine platforms, patient engagement solutions, remote patient monitoring tools, and other solutions.
Learn more
medical worker pointing at something on the screen

Pharmaceutical

Speeding up drug discovery and development through drug dossier software, pharmacovigilance solutions, pharmacy management systems, and other Java applications.
Learn more
medical worker

Fintech

Empowering fintech companies to provide secure and efficient financial services through CLMS solutions, online payment systems, banking apps, and other software.
Learn more
office building
a blue and purple gradient

Build your Java development team in 5 easy steps

Step 1
Initial inquiry You fill in the contact form and request Java development services. We get back to you within one business day.
Step 2 a female IT expert in a virtual meeting with her collegues. She sits in front of her laptop but stares at the TV on the left for some reason
Scoping call We organize a scoping call during which we define your business objectives, budget, timelines, and required expertise.
Step 3
Team assembly Based on your requirements, we assemble a Java development team that best fits your project. You can interview candidates yourself or leave it to us.
Step 4
Team approval You approve the provided IT experts, and we sign an agreement. You have a 14-day free trial period to properly assess each candidate.
Step 5
Onboarding We assist you with onboarding your new team members, ensuring they quickly integrate into your team and start delivering value.

Hire senior-level Java developers and see your product vision come to life

Custom Java development services recognized worldwide

Helpware Tech is a Java software development company trusted by both startups and established enterprises. 93% of our customers are satisfied with our services, and 80% come back for more.
5.0
4.9
based on 29 reviews
4.6

Why choose HW.Tech as your Java development company?

a finger pointing at a macbook
100% compliance
We create Java solutions with compliance in mind, ensuring adherence to government regulations and standards in your industry.
granule
Uncompromised quality
We develop ISO 25010-compliant Java software solutions that deliver superior performance while helping you achieve your business objectives.
macbook's keyboard, fn, control, option
Visibility & control
You will have access to a centralized project dashboard with regular progress reports; all upcoming expenses will be discussed in advance.
two guys looking at a screen, the bearded one smiling
Your IP, our support
You retain full intellectual property rights to your Java product(s). We also provide post-launch maintenance and support with regular security audits.
a blurry image of a blue and purple light

Client testimonials

4.8
TrustPilot
5.0
Clutch

“Helpware Tech’s high-quality work received glowing praises from the client due to their organized and transparent development. Their outstanding project management complemented their top-notch coding skills — they were flexible, accommodating, and easy to work with.“

Jordan Waid

Director, Percepi Knowledge Ltd

4.8
TrustPilot
5.0
Clutch

“Transparency in communication is a fantastic skill for a partner to have. In addition, Helpware Tech proved their expertise among a vast range of technologies, which was emphasized by our client. The project manager was extremely responsive. He was available 24/7 to cover all questions and demonstrate progress as needed.“

Andre Kholodov

CEO, ADUK GmbH

4.8
TrustPilot
5.0
Clutch

“The solution that Helpware Tech developed is fully-functional and mobile-friendly. It meets all of the company's expectations. The company appreciated the team's project management, as it suited their own structure. The team even made themselves flexible to accomodate the company's schedule.”

Corbin Fraser

Group Product Manager, Mobile Services, Bitcoin.com

4.8
TrustPilot
5.0
Clutch

"I’d recommend HW.Tech because I felt their engagement and understanding of our business. They offered the best solution provision of what we were looking for. They were very responsive to the requests, very flexible, just going in flow with our changes."

Alan Ball

Managing Partner, Octagon Medical Practice

4.8
TrustPilot
5.0
Clutch

"With the support of our partners, we have created a platform that will provide developers with an efficient way to raise project capital and enable investors to actively choose which carbon offset projects they would like to support. Helpware Tech is a highly reliable and efficient development partner, providing excellent project management, timely communication, and commitment to go the extra mile when needed."

Steven Lowenthal

Co-CEO and Co-Founder, Frontier Carbon Solutions

a blue and purple light

Choose a suitable engagement model

End-to-end Java development
We take full responsibility for your product, from initial concept to final delivery, working closely with stakeholders at every stage of the development process.
a man pointing to a computer screen with lines of code, a female looking at the screen, probably smiling
Dedicated Java development team
We dedicate a team to your project and manage it on your behalf, freeing up your time for core business activities.
a group of people, one lady drawing something on a wall with a red marker
Java staff augmentation
We bridge your talent gaps by integrating our brightest minds into your in-house team while you maintain full control over your project.
male healthcare expert

Turn bold ideas into powerful digital solutions with expert Java software development services

FAQ

How does outsourcing to your Java development company work?
Java developers outsourcing with Helpware Tech is a straightforward and transparent process that takes 5 steps.

Step 1: Initial inquiry. You contact our Java development company via the website form or by using another convenient method of communication. We get back to you within one business day to organize a scoping call.

Step 2: Scoping call. We organize a scoping call during which we define your business objectives, budget, timelines, and required expertise.

Step 3: Team assembly. Based on your requirements, we assemble a Java development team that best fits your project. You can interview candidates yourself or leave it to us.

Step 4: Team approval. You approve the provided Java developers, and we sign an agreement. You have a 14-day free trial period to properly assess each candidate. If you are not satisfied with someone, we’ll replace them for free within 5 business days after your request.

Step 5: Onboarding. We assist you with onboarding your new team members, ensuring they quickly integrate into your team and start delivering value.
What tools and frameworks do your Java developers use?
Our Java developers use a wide range of Java-specific tools and frameworks, including Java frameworks: Spring Framework, Play Framework, Ratpack, Vert.x, Quarkus, Micronaut, Hibernate, Jakarta EE, Java EE, and Java J2EE. Apart from that, our team has developed projects with Python, Django, Ruby on Rails, Go, Node.js, PHP, Swift, Kotlin, React, React, and many other programming languages and frameworks.

Our diverse expertise and hands-on experience with enterprise-level projects make us one of the best Java development companies worldwide. Whether you need to augment your team or want to hire a dedicated team for your project, Helpware Tech is the right choice.
How do you ensure the high quality of your Java solutions?
To ensure our Java applications are of top-notch quality, we follow a set of Java development principles.

Code rules and guidelines

We follow the Java style guide, use descriptive names for variables, split code into short and focused units, ensure comprehensive unit tests, and prioritize keeping the code portable.

Java code documentation and organization

We document our Java code thoroughly with comments explaining specific code functions. We maintain a final README file outlining the overall functionality and dependencies of the code.

Java code review practices

We conduct regular code reviews through ad hoc reviews, pass-arounds, walkthroughs, pull requests, and formal inspections to ensure the code meets high-quality standards.

Java code quality metrics

We track code quality through various metrics, including the Maintainability Index (MI), Cyclomatic Complexity (CC), Depth of Inheritance, Class Coupling, Lines of Code, and Halstead Volume.
How will you keep me updated regarding my Java project’s progress?
We provide Java development services with the customer in mind and always strive to deliver the best experience. We’ll assign you a project manager who will communicate with you and stakeholders at every development stage so that you’re always informed about where your investment goes. You will have direct control over your project and will be able to suggest improvements on the fly. Whenever you feel like it, you can organize a call with the team to ensure productive work, with everyone on the same page.
Do you follow government regulations and quality standards in Java development services?
Naturally! As a reliable Java development company in the USA, HW.Tech follows government regulations and quality standards in software development. More specifically, we follow ISO 9001, ISO 27001, and ISO 25010 practices and adhere to HIPAA, GDPR, the EU AI Act, AML, KYC, and PCI DSS regulations.
How much do custom Java development services cost?
The cost of Java development services depends on a huge variety of factors. Team expertise, project complexity, UI/UX design requirements, location of the team, timeframes and deadlines, security requirements—all these and many other parameters come into play and influence the cost of Java development. If you’d like to receive a cost estimate for your Java project, feel free to contact us at your convenience. Use the “Book a call” button in the upper right corner and leave some details about your Java initiative. We’ll get back to you within one business day.
a blurry image of a blue and purple light
2148,1885 px 243,64 Arrow